Matt Clement Will Wear Red In ‘08

by Texy
2008 January 3 at 4:43 pm

Matt Clement is heading back to the National League from whence he came: the St. Louis Cardinals signed him today to a one-year deal for an undisclosed amount, with a club option for 2009. So he’ll again be wearing red this season… just of a different variety.

Clement had surgery in the fall of 2006 that kept him off the mound for the Red Sox for the entirety of 2007. The last time Matt pitched? June of ‘06. This offseason, the club declined to offer him arbitration, so the Sox and Clement officially parted ways.
